Enhancing Maritime Security with Airborne Technology
On May 7, 2026, UMag Solutions officially launched F1Mag4;, an advanced unmanned system for the rapid detection of naval mines and submarines. This system aims to enhance maritime security globally by providing a safer, more efficient method of detecting underwater threats.
Equipped with the F1Mag4; system, drones can scan vast areas of up to 6,000 hectares per hour. This airborne technology identifies underwater threats without risking personnel or deploying vessels. F1Mag4; detects moored and bottom mines, submarines, and uncrewed underwater vehicles (UUVs) at depths reaching 500 meters. This capability is critical in regions where naval mines disrupt trade and pose security threats.
In the Strait of Hormuz, roughly 20% of global seaborne oil and a quarter of LNG trade transits through this chokepoint. Since early 2026, Iranian mine-laying activity has led to an active clearance campaign. Reports indicate even the mine-layers have lost track of what was deployed. NATO has increased patrols while proving the absence of a mine is now more challenging than finding one.
The Baltic Sea, with its shallow waters and heavy traffic, remains under the watchful eye of NATO’s Baltic Sentry mission. Since 2022, a string of cable, pipeline, and power-link incidents has made rapid, wide-area subsea screening essential.
Meanwhile, in the Black Sea, drifting mines from ongoing conflicts, particularly the Russia-Ukraine war, continue to threaten shipping. These mines have re-emerged as cost-effective and politically disruptive weapons. A single mine can spike insurance premiums and reroute global trade, highlighting the urgent need for solutions like F1Mag4;.

Key Features of F1Mag4;
Compatible with a range of drone platforms, F1Mag4; can be integrated into defence services worldwide. It provides real-time data transmission, ensuring immediate operational intelligence without delays. The system’s drone-agnostic design allows for use across various platforms, including UMS Skeldar and High-Eye, meeting the diverse needs of defence forces.

The launch of F1Mag4; comes at a time of increasing geopolitical tensions. Effective and wide-area screening is necessary to maintain maritime safety in strategic regions. Because F1Mag4; operates from the air, it is less dependent on weather, sea state, or vessel support, making it unaffected by sea ice, muddy waters, or boundary layers in the water column.
